What is the cheapest month to fly from Dallas/Fort Worth Airport to Beijing Capital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Dallas/Fort Worth Airport to Beijing Capital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Dallas/Fort Worth Airport to Beijing Capital Airport is November, where tickets cost $1,128 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and June,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$2,571 and $2,033 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Dallas/Fort Worth Airport to Beijing Capital Airport?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Beijing Capital Airport with an airline and back to Dallas/Fort Worth Airport with another airline. Booking your flights between Dallas/Fort Worth Airport and PEK can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
